News & Updates

The Ultimate Guide to Indexing Options: Boost Search Visibility

By Marcus Reyes 46 Views
indexing options
The Ultimate Guide to Indexing Options: Boost Search Visibility

Modern digital environments generate data at a scale that is difficult to comprehend. Files, documents, and logs accumulate in systems every second, creating sprawling digital landscapes that are impossible to navigate without structure. Indexing options serve as the foundational framework for taming this complexity, transforming chaotic repositories into organized and accessible information hubs.

Understanding the Mechanics of Indexing

At its core, an index is a data structure that improves the speed of data retrieval operations. Rather than scanning every file or record sequentially—a process that is inefficient and slow—the system creates a map of references. This map allows the search mechanism to pinpoint the exact location of the desired content instantly. The process involves crawling through source material, parsing the content to identify distinct elements, and then storing these elements in a database optimized for quick lookups.

Strategic Options for File Systems

When managing local or network storage, administrators rely on specific indexing options to balance performance with resource consumption. The choice often depends on the nature of the workload and the hardware specifications. There are generally two primary strategies employed to maintain efficiency.

Real-Time Monitoring: This option keeps a constant watch on the file system, updating the index immediately as files are created, modified, or deleted. It ensures that search results are always current, though it requires a consistent allocation of CPU and memory resources.

Scheduled Updates: Alternatively, systems can be configured to update the index at set intervals, such as during off-peak hours. This method minimizes the impact on system performance during high-activity periods, but users might encounter delays in seeing the latest additions or changes in search results.

Database Optimization Techniques

For applications handling structured data, indexing options extend beyond simple file management to database optimization. Databases utilize indexes to sort data efficiently, which is critical for the speed of complex queries. Selecting the right type of database index—such as B-trees for range queries or hash indexes for exact matches—can mean the difference between a millisecond response time and a system bottleneck.

Designers must carefully consider which columns to index. While an index accelerates read operations, it introduces overhead for write processes. Every time a new record is inserted or an existing one is updated, the index must be modified as well. Therefore, the strategic indexing options involve a trade-off between read speed and write performance, requiring a deep understanding of the application’s usage patterns.

In large organizations, the challenge is not merely storing data, but finding the right piece of data across disparate systems. Enterprise search platforms provide unified indexing options that aggregate content from emails, documents, databases, and cloud storage. These solutions often include advanced features like semantic analysis and natural language processing to understand the context of a search query, rather than just matching keywords.

The configuration of these platforms usually involves defining content sources, setting crawl schedules, and determining security protocols. Administrators must decide which documents are public, which are restricted to specific departments, and which are confidential. These security-based indexing options ensure that sensitive information remains protected while still being discoverable to authorized users.

The Impact on User Experience

Ultimately, the effectiveness of indexing options is measured by the end-user experience. A well-indexed system feels instantaneous; users rarely wait for results and rarely encounter dead ends. Conversely, poor indexing leads to frustration, as users are forced to navigate nested folders or refine vague searches repeatedly.

Modern expectations demand relevance and speed. Search algorithms leverage indexing metadata to rank results by importance, ensuring that the most relevant documents appear at the top. This relevance tuning is a critical indexing option that relies on understanding user behavior and content metadata to deliver the most accurate information efficiently.

The landscape of indexing is evolving rapidly with the integration of artificial intelligence. Traditional indexing options are being augmented by machine learning models that can automatically tag content, detect anomalies, and predict user intent. These intelligent systems move beyond simple keyword matching to understand the substance of the content itself.

M

Written by Marcus Reyes

Marcus Reyes is a Senior Editor with 15 years of experience investigating complex global narratives. He brings razor-sharp analysis and unapologetic perspective to every story.